Cat M.

Enjoyed a lovely dinner here. Great menu & we loved that it was BYO. Atmosphere could use some updating & softer surfaces as it was extremely loud in there. Seemed they were missing a server. We had to ask for water twice & it took a while for them to clear the dirty dishes. Food was excellent. We enjoyed the tri color salad (split for us), goat cheese salad, & fig crostini to start. We also got a nice bread basket & we liked how they had olive oil on the table. Entree's: Rigatoni Bolognese was so good & such a large portion! We also enjoyed the arctic char & chicken milanese. The carrot cake was delish & expresso's were good. All in all, I would come back!

Karina U.

Love that they have an entire GF menu (as well as non-GF bread and pasta available). The staff is incredibly attentive and responsive to your dining needs too (very helpful especially since we had a small snafu that they corrected immediately). We started out with a full basket of GF bread (really good flavor and brought out hot but the crust was a little too hard), the calamari (really well cooked and tender with solid breading and delicious sauce, although my bf thought there could be more flavor to the breading), lobster fra diavolo (really spicy but in a good way), and chicken Marsala (which my bf really enjoyed). I ended with the affogato which was absolutely delicious. Overall, I thought the meal was great and I would definitely return and try their rice balls and other items. It's BYO and a popular spot so I'd recommend a reservation for busy weekend nights.

Frankie R.

You can tell all the food from Robert's Scratch Kitchen is fresh and made to order. They don't skimp on the quality of ingredients here. They also always have a great variety of specials. It is a little pricy but you are paying for high quality for sure. The atmosphere is very nice; it's deceiving since you wouldn't expect a strip mall restaurant to be so modern on the inside! The staff is friendly and attentive. Truly (and shamelessly) my favorite thing on the menu is the peanut butter tower dessert. It's a must order if you are a PB and chocolate lover. I'll always save room for this. Extra points for BYOB as well!

Is the gluten free pasta all penne, or are there other varieties?

We have gluten free penned gluten free spaghetti and gluten free gnocchi
